II. Equipment Configuration and Technical Features
The main configuration of the through-type shot blasting machine delivered this time is as follows:
**Conveying System**: Utilizes a variable frequency speed-regulating roller conveyor. The conveying speed can be adjusted according to the steel pipe specifications and cleaning requirements. The lengths of the input and output roller conveyors are customized according to the customer's site layout.
**Shot Blasting System**: Equipped with multiple high-efficiency shot blasters, arranged above and to the sides of the steel pipe, ensuring uniform impact on all surfaces of the steel pipe's outer wall.
**Shot Circulation System**: Employs a combination of screw conveyor and bucket elevator to achieve automatic shot recovery, screening, and recycling.
**Dust Removal System**: Equipped with a high-efficiency cartridge dust collector. Dust emission concentrations meet environmental standards, ensuring a clean working environment.
**Control System**: Employs PLC control with a touchscreen operating interface. It can store multiple sets of process parameters, facilitating switching between different steel pipe specifications.
III. On-site Installation and Commissioning
After the equipment arrived at the customer's site, our technicians immediately commenced installation work. The installation process included roller conveyor positioning, shot blasting chamber assembly, dust removal system connection, electrical wiring, and system commissioning. The entire installation and commissioning cycle took approximately 12 days.
During commissioning, technicians conducted test blasting on steel pipes of different diameters. Based on the cleaning results, they adjusted the shot blaster angle, roller speed, and shot flow rate to ensure the cleanliness standards required by the customer were met.
IV. Cleaning Effect Demonstration
After the equipment was put into operation, the customer expressed satisfaction with the cleaning effect. The following is a comparison before and after cleaning:
**Before Cleaning**: The steel pipe surface had rolled oxide scale, slight rust, and oil stains, and the surface color was uneven.
**After Cleaning**: The oxide scale and rust were completely removed, revealing a uniform metallic color. The surface cleanliness reached Sa2.5 standard. The steel pipe surface exhibited uniform roughness, providing a good adhesion base for subsequent coating.
V. Advantages of Through-Type Shot Blasting Machines in Steel Pipe Cleaning
Through-type shot blasting machines have the following outstanding advantages in cleaning the outer walls of steel pipes:
**High Efficiency of Continuous Operation**: Steel pipes are continuously conveyed via roller conveyors, and loading and unloading can be seamlessly integrated with upstream and downstream processes, making it suitable for mass production.
**Uniform Cleaning Effect:** Multiple shot blasters project shot from different angles, and the steel pipe rotates simultaneously during its journey, ensuring even impact on all surfaces of the outer wall.
**Easy Operation:** The PLC control system can store process parameters for various steel pipes, allowing for one-click recall when switching specifications.
**Environmentally Compliant:** Equipped with a dust removal system, dust is prevented from escaping during operation, meeting environmental protection requirements.
**Low Operating Costs:** Shot is automatically recycled, resulting in low consumption; the equipment has a low failure rate, and maintenance costs are controllable.
